About the Book

This book constitutes the refereed proceedings of the 20th National Conference on Man-Machine Speech Communication, NCMMSC 2025, held in Zhenjiang, China, during October 16-19, 2025. The 40 papers included in these proceedings were carefully reviewed and selected from 157 submissions. the conference will feature special events such as a Young Scholars Forum, Student Forum, Industry Forum, and Product and Technology Exhibition. Beyond the main program, the conference will also include publicoutreach activities, grant-writing workshops, and several special sessions.
